SynthID AI Watermark for Video: How Google Protects AI-Generated Content

Every video generated by Google DeepMind’s AI systems — including those created through the gemini omni multimodal model — carries an invisible digital fingerprint called SynthID. The watermark is embedded directly into the video’s pixels, not a removable metadata tag, so it survives social-media recompression, cropping, and re-encoding. According to Google DeepMind, SynthID has already marked over 100 billion AI-generated images and videos — the largest AI-watermarking deployment in existence.
How SynthID Works
SynthID modifies pixel values in a way that is statistically invisible to the human eye but forms a detectable pattern for Google’s verification algorithm. Its defining properties:
- Imperceptibility — no visible change to the video during playback.
- Robustness — survives MP4 recompression, downscaling, cropping, color grading, and re-uploads.
- Detection, not identity — confirms “this was AI-generated” rather than decoding who made it.
This matters because humans correctly identify AI deepfakes only about 25% of the time — barely above chance — so visual inspection alone can’t distinguish real footage from synthetic. SynthID also works alongside C2PA Content Credentials, the open provenance standard from Adobe, Microsoft, Sony, and news organizations. C2PA metadata can be stripped; SynthID’s pixel signal cannot — together they form a dual-layer record.
Mandatory Across the Gemini Omni Stack
SynthID is non-optional in Gemini Omni. Every output — text-to-video, image-to-video, or conversational editing — is watermarked before delivery, across all tiers: free YouTube Shorts, paid subscribers, and developers on the Gemini API. In multi-turn editing, each refined version receives a fresh mark, so provenance propagates through every edit — valuable for fact-checkers verifying heavily edited derivatives.
The same safety framework withholds audio/speech editing (the highest-risk voice-cloning vector) and requires a consent recording before any avatar likeness can be used. The same watermarking runs across Veo, Google Flow, and Google Photos Video Remix, so any Google surface produces the same verifiable signal.
Limitations
- Detection requires Google’s tools — no independent third-party verification is public yet.
- Covers Google’s AI only — video from Sora, Runway, Kling, or Seedance carries no SynthID mark.
- Not unconditionally unremovable — robust to common transforms, but Google does not claim immunity to aggressive adversarial attacks.
The Gemini API documentation frames SynthID as one layer in a multi-part safety architecture, and the Generative AI Use Policy makes it the technical enforcement mechanism against AI content that deceives users about its origin.
FAQ
Does SynthID affect video quality?
No. The pixel modifications are below the threshold of human perception and do not degrade resolution, frame rate, or audio.
Can SynthID watermarks be removed?
They are robust against recompression, cropping, and color grading — far harder to remove than metadata labels — but Google does not claim absolute robustness against all adversarial attacks.
Is SynthID used in free YouTube Shorts generation?
Yes. All Gemini Omni outputs, including free-tier YouTube Shorts and Create App videos, are watermarked automatically.
Can I verify a SynthID watermark independently?
Not yet. Verification currently requires access to Google’s detection tools; public third-party verification is not available.
